Introduction to the Fashion Industry Crisis
The fashion industry is currently grappling with a multifaceted crisis primarily driven by the rise of fast fashion. This model prioritizes rapid production and low costs, which has significant repercussions for both the environment and society. Fast fashion brands frequently produce large quantities of clothing with minimal investment in quality, leading to products that ultimately contribute to excessive waste. It is estimated that the global fashion industry emits more greenhouse gases than the entire economies of France, Germany, and the United Kingdom combined, highlighting the urgent need for change.
Additionally, the rapid production cycles demanded by fast fashion contribute to unsustainable practices. Brands often operate under tight deadlines that encourage the use of subpar materials and exploitative manufacturing processes in developing countries. Workers in these regions often endure poor working conditions, long hours, and inadequate pay, raising ethical concerns about labor rights. The pursuit of cheap labor to maintain profit margins exacerbates social inequalities and diminishes the dignity of those involved in the fashion supply chain.
Moreover, the environmental impact of fast fashion extends beyond carbon emissions. The industry is a significant contributor to water pollution, with the dyeing and finishing processes using harmful chemicals that can contaminate water sources. Furthermore, a large volume of discarded clothing ends up in landfills each year, with many fabrics taking decades, if not centuries, to decompose. As consumers increasingly become aware of these issues, there is a growing demand for more responsible practices within the fashion industry.
Thus, the urgent need for a shift toward sustainability is becoming increasingly clear. As both environmental degradation and social injustices linked to fast fashion are laid bare, stakeholders across the industry must explore innovative solutions that prioritize ethical and sustainable practices in fashion production and consumption.
Understanding Smart Fashion: What Is It?
Smart fashion is an innovative concept that represents a significant shift from traditional fast fashion to a more sustainable and technologically advanced approach in the apparel industry. At its core, smart fashion integrates modern technologies—including data analytics, artificial intelligence, and automation—with a focus on environmental preservation and ethical production. This paradigm shift is driven by growing consumer awareness regarding the environmental and social impacts of fashion, marking a shift from mere trend-following to conscientious consumption.
In stark contrast to conventional fast fashion, which prioritizes speed and low cost at the expense of quality and sustainability, smart fashion emphasizes durability, reparability, and ethical sourcing. Fast fashion often relies on rapid product turnover, leading to waste and exploitation of labor. Conversely, smart fashion utilizes data analytics to predict consumer behavior, allowing brands to manufacture products more efficiently and in alignment with real demand. By leveraging technology, the industry can minimize overproduction and reduce excess inventory, thus contributing to environmental sustainability.
Moreover, smart fashion promotes transparency throughout the supply chain. Brands adopting smart fashion principles are increasingly focused on providing information about product origins, manufacturing processes, and labor practices. Many of these organizations harness blockchain technology to ensure traceability. By doing so, they empower consumers to make informed choices aligned with their ethical values.
The rise of smart fashion reflects a broader commitment to sustainable development, where ecological concerns and technological innovation converge. As consumers increasingly prioritize sustainable practices, it is imperative for brands to embrace smart fashion as a way to address these changing demands. This evolution not only holds potential for environmental benefits but also sets a precedent for ethical consumerism within the fashion industry.
The Role of AI in Sustainable Fashion
Artificial Intelligence (AI) is increasingly influencing various industries, and the fashion sector is no exception. The integration of AI technologies, particularly machine learning and predictive analytics, represents a significant shift towards achieving sustainability in fashion. These technologies allow brands to better understand consumer preferences, enabling them to forecast trends with remarkable accuracy. By analyzing vast amounts of data, AI tools help brands determine which styles, colors, and materials are likely to resonate with consumers, thereby minimizing overproduction and waste.
Moreover, AI-driven tools streamline production processes. By optimizing inventory management, brands can reduce excess stock and avoid the common pitfalls of fast fashion. For instance, AI algorithms can analyze historical sales data alongside real-time market trends to recommend precise production quantities, aligning supply with actual demand. This not only conserves resources but also significantly lowers the environmental footprint of the fashion industry.
Waste reduction is another critical area where AI proves beneficial. Advanced analytics can identify inefficiencies in supply chains, allowing brands to implement strategies that minimize material waste. For example, AI systems can assess fabric utilization during the cutting process, suggesting optimal layouts that reduce leftover scraps. Furthermore, AI technologies can support recycling initiatives by predicting the types of clothing that are more likely to be recycled, thereby enhancing circular economy efforts in the fashion industry.
As the fashion landscape evolves, the capabilities of AI are expanding, creating opportunities for brands to adopt more sustainable practices. The intersection of technology and sustainability is vital for the industry's future, as consumers increasingly demand responsible production methods. By harnessing the power of AI, fashion brands are better equipped to navigate these challenges while contributing to a more sustainable framework that prioritizes environmental responsibility.

Automation and Supply Chain Transparency
The integration of automation technologies within the fashion industry is significantly reshaping production and distribution processes. Automation facilitates increased efficiency, enabling brands to respond to market demands promptly while minimizing waste. For instance, automated cutting machines and sewing robots expedite garment production, allowing companies to maintain a competitive edge. Additionally, digital tools streamline inventory management, predicting stock levels and reducing overproduction—an essential aspect of the broader objective of sustainable fashion.
Supply chain transparency has emerged as a crucial factor in cultivating consumer trust. Today's well-informed consumers increasingly seek information about the origins of their clothing, fostering demand for brands that embrace ethical sourcing practices. Automated systems play a pivotal role in enhancing transparency; they enable fashion companies to monitor every stage of the supply chain, from raw material extraction to final delivery. Utilizing advanced tracking technologies, brands can provide verifiable information regarding the ethicality of their sourcing practices, which cultivates client loyalty and drives responsible consumer behavior.
Moreover, tech-driven solutions empower brands to conduct comprehensive audits of their supply chains. These solutions may include blockchain technology, which allows for immutable record-keeping and unprecedented visibility into sourcing practices. Through the application of such technologies, companies can ensure their suppliers adhere to ethical standards, thereby reinforcing their commitment to sustainability. This level of accountability promotes responsible consumption, aligning with a broader movement toward environmental protection.
As the fashion industry increasingly embraces automation, it not only enhances operational efficiency but also fortifies the principles of ethical sourcing and transparency. By leveraging these technological advancements, brands can significantly influence consumer trust while simultaneously contributing to sustainable practices in an evolving marketplace.
Challenges and Limitations of AI-Driven Sustainability
The integration of artificial intelligence (AI) in the fashion industry presents several hurdles that must be addressed to fully realize its sustainability potential. One significant challenge is data privacy, as consumers increasingly express concerns about how their personal information is collected, stored, and utilized. Fashion brands leveraging AI often require vast amounts of data to create personalized shopping experiences or optimize supply chains. However, if not handled transparently and responsibly, such data practices can lead to distrust among consumers, ultimately affecting brand loyalty and reputation.
Another issue lies in the technological barriers that smaller or emerging fashion brands face. Unlike larger corporations, which may have the resources to implement advanced data analytics systems and AI technologies, smaller brands may struggle to invest in these innovations. This disparity can result in a two-tiered system within the industry where only established players can effectively compete in the arena of sustainable fashion. Therefore, it is essential to recognize that equitable access to AI tools is crucial for fostering inclusivity and diversity within the fashion sector.
Furthermore, there is the risk of over-reliance on algorithms in decision-making processes. While AI can provide valuable insights and improve operational efficiencies, a dependence on data-driven algorithms can potentially lead to a reduction in human oversight and intuition. This reliance could stifle creativity and innovation, essential characteristics of the fashion industry. Designers and decision-makers must strike an appropriate balance between leveraging AI capabilities and retaining the human element to ensure that sustainability initiatives resonate authentically with consumers.
While AI-driven solutions offer promising avenues for advancing sustainability, addressing these challenges and limitations is vital to create a more equitable and responsible fashion industry.
